Note: In earlier firmware versions, if you enabled local protection, it prevented you from being able to do a factory reset. If the factory reset process is not working for you, you may want to try to disable local protection first, and then try the reset again. https://help.inovelli.com/en/articles/8236263-blue-series-2-1-switch-button-combinations-quick-tap-sequences-local-configuration-options#h_6d7f776636

There may come a time when you need to factory reset your Blue Series Dimmer Switch. This article will walk you through that process.

To factory reset your Blue Series Dimmer Switch, please follow the directions below:

  • Hold Down on the top of the Paddle (A) (or the On button) while simultaneously holding down the Config/Favorites Button (C) for approximately 20 seconds until the LED Bar (D) flashes Red

  • Then let go of both the top of the Paddle (A) and the Config/Favorites Button (C)

  • If successful, the LED Bar (D) will start to pulse Blue
